History and development:
Online poker appeared in belated 1990s as a consequence of breakthroughs in technology and the net. The first on-line poker space, Planet Poker, was released in 1998, attracting a small but enthusiastic community. However, it was in early 2000s that on-line poker experienced exponential growth, mostly due to the intro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.

Popularity and Accessibility:
One of the main grounds for the immense popularity of on-line poker is its ease of access. People can log in to their favorite on-line poker systems anytime, from anywhere, using their computer systems or mobile devices. This convenience has drawn a diverse player base, including recreational people to specialists, adding to the quick expansion of internet poker.

Features of Online Poker:
Internet poker provides a number of advantages over standard brick-and-mortar casinos. Firstly, it gives a larger number of online game options, including various poker variants and high stakes, catering towards choices and budgets of all of the forms of players. Also, on-line poker rooms are open 24/7, eliminating the constraints of physical casino running hours. Moreover, on line platforms frequently offer appealing bonuses, loyalty programs, in addition to capacity to play numerous tables simultaneously, enhancing the overall gaming experience.

Economic and Personal Influence:
The rise of internet poker has already established a significant financial effect globally. Internet poker platforms generate significant revenue through rake costs, tournament entry charges, and marketing. This revenue has actually resulted in job creation and opportunities inside video gaming industry. Moreover, internet poker features contributed to an increase in tax income for governing bodies where it's managed, promoting public services.

From a personal viewpoint, online poker features fostered a worldwide poker neighborhood, bridging geographic obstacles. Players from diverse experiences and areas can interact and compete, fostering a sense of camaraderie. Internet poker in addition has played a vital role in promoting the game's popularity and attracting brand-new people, leading to the expansion of poker business as a whole.
